PLCs interface with PDAs, cell phones

Staff -- Industrial Distribution, 4/1/2003

PASADENA, CALIF. — Pacific Microinstruments, Inc. released a new version of the PLC Pilot™ application that enables users to interface mobile devices to Allen Bradley MicroLogix™ programmable logic controllers.

The PLC Pilot-AB is compatible with Palm Powered mobile devices offered by Palm, Handspring, Sony, Kyocera, Handera, and Samsung. The target users of the new software include field service personnel and engineers who want to eliminate the need for laptops and PCs when interfacing to Micrologix PLC-based equipment.
